MARGAO, Jan. 31 -- Team Herald
The Green Goa Foundation (GGF) has lodged a formal complaint with the Superintendent of Police, demanding immediate action against those responsible for damaging a public parking area due to the erection of stalls for the annual feast fair. The foundation has also held the Cuncolim Municipal Council accountable for allegedly failing to protect public property.
GGF Chairman Raison Almeida criticized the damage caused by stall owners who dug up sections of the parking and roadside areas, calling it a blatant violation of public property rights.
